首页 > 编程 > Python > 正文

wxPython框架类和面板类的使用实例

2020-02-23 05:54:12
字体:
来源:转载
供稿:网友

本文实例讲述了wxPython框架类和面板类的使用方法,分享给大家供大家参考。具体分析如下:

实现代码如下:

import wx   class MyApp(wx.App):  #自定义应用程序类,类中调用自定义的框架类   def OnInit(self):     self.frame = MyFrame(None, title = "My Main Frame jb51.net")     self.SetTopWindow(self.frame)     self.frame.Show()      return True  class MyFrame(wx.Frame): #自定义框架类,自定义的框架类中有一个panel的属性   def __init__(self, parent, id=wx.ID_ANY, title=""):     super(MyFrame, self).__init__(parent, id ,title)         # Attributes      self.panel = wx.Panel(self)  if __name__ == "__main__":   app = MyApp()   app.MainLoop()

程序运行效果如下图所示:

希望本文所述对大家的Python程序设计有所帮助。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表